Function & Operational Principles

The primary function of the Honghua HHF 1000 Crankshaft Assembly is to convert the rotational power from the pinion shaft into the linear reciprocating motion needed for the fluid end to operate. The assembly operates through a precise mechanical mechanism: the GH3101-02.10B Widened Bull Gear is connected to the pinion shaft, which drives the bull gear and the attached GH3101-02.08.00 Crankshaft to rotate.

As the crankshaft rotates, its eccentric journals move in a circular path, which is converted into linear motion by the GH3101-02.06 Connecting Rods. The connecting rods transmit this linear motion to the crosshead assembly, which then drives the piston rods in the fluid end. The GH3101-02.22 Main Bearings (3G4053156H) support the crankshaft, reducing friction and allowing smooth rotation under high loads, while the GH3101-02.21 Eccentric Wheel Bearings (929/558.8QU) ensure smooth movement of the connecting rods. Locating rings and shim sets maintain precise alignment of the crankshaft and bull gear, preventing misalignment and excessive wear. Sealing elements—including gaskets and threaded sealant—prevent lubricant leakage and keep drilling dust, mud, and debris out of the assembly, while main bearing covers and retainers protect internal components from external damage.

Maintenance & Care Recommendations

Proper maintenance of the crankshaft assembly is critical to ensuring stable power conversion and preventing costly mechanical failures. Follow these practical, on-site guidelines to maximize component life and pump reliability:

  1. Inspect all seal gaskets and 242 Threaded Sealant every 200 operating hours for wear, cracks, or leakage. Replace worn gaskets with our compatible parts and reapply threaded sealant to prevent lubricant leakage, which can cause bearing failure.
  2. Check the main bearings (GH3101-02.22) and eccentric wheel bearings (GH3101-02.21) every 500 operating hours for noise, overheating, or play. Lubricate the bearings with high-quality gear oil (ISO VG 220) and replace them if they show signs of wear or damage.
  3. Inspect the crankshaft (GH3101-02.08.00) every 800 operating hours for cracks, journal wear, or misalignment. Use a dial indicator to check alignment (tolerance ±0.02mm) and replace the crankshaft if journal wear exceeds 0.2mm or cracks are detected.
  4. Tighten all bolts every 200 operating hours to the recommended torque (200 N·m for 2 1/2-8UN bolts, 150 N·m for 1 1/4-8UN bolts). Replace any worn or damaged fasteners with our compatible parts and reapply locking wires to secure them.
  5. Check the bull gear (GH3101-02.10B) every 1,000 operating hours for tooth wear or damage. Replace the bull gear if tooth wear exceeds 0.3mm, and ensure proper alignment with the pinion shaft.
  6. Adjust the shim sets (GH3101-02.19.00) every 600 operating hours to maintain crankshaft alignment. Clean the shim surfaces and ensure they are properly seated to prevent misalignment.
  7. Store spare parts in a clean, dry environment (0°C–25°C) to prevent corrosion. Keep bearings and crankshafts in sealed containers to avoid damage from dust or moisture, and avoid storing crankshafts in positions that could cause bending.

On-Site Fault Maintenance Cases

Case 1: Main Bearing Failure & Crankshaft Overheating

Scenario: An onshore rig reported excessive overheating of the crankshaft assembly (temperature exceeding 120°C) and abnormal noise from the power end. The pump’s vibration increased significantly, and rotational speed became unstable.

Root Cause: The GH3101-02.22 Main Bearing (3G4053156H) was worn and contaminated with metal particles, causing excessive friction. The bearing had not been lubricated for 600 operating hours, leading to dry friction and overheating.

Solution: Replaced the worn main bearing with our compatible part, flushed the assembly to remove contaminants, and refilled it with ISO VG 220 gear oil. After maintenance, the crankshaft temperature dropped to 80°C, vibration returned to normal, and the abnormal noise was eliminated.

Case 2: Crankshaft Misalignment & Connecting Rod Wear

Scenario: A drilling team noticed uneven wear on the connecting rods and reduced pump efficiency. Inspection revealed the crankshaft was misaligned, causing excessive stress on the connecting rods and eccentric wheel bearings.

Root Cause: The GH3101-02.19.00 Shim Set was worn and uneven, leading to crankshaft misalignment. The locating rings were also damaged, exacerbating the issue and causing the connecting rods to wear unevenly.

Solution: Replaced the shim set and damaged locating rings with our compatible parts, adjusted the crankshaft alignment to within ±0.02mm, and lubricated all bearings and connecting rods. The connecting rod wear stopped, and pump efficiency was restored to 100%.

Case 3: Bull Gear Tooth Damage & Power Loss

Scenario: An offshore rig experienced significant power loss and abnormal gear noise from the crankshaft assembly. Inspection revealed the GH3101-02.10B Widened Bull Gear had damaged teeth, preventing proper power transmission from the pinion shaft.

Root Cause: The bull gear teeth were worn due to improper alignment with the pinion shaft and lack of regular lubrication. The gear had not been inspected for 1,200 operating hours, allowing wear to progress to the point of damage.

Solution: Replaced the damaged bull gear with our compatible part, adjusted the alignment between the bull gear and pinion shaft, and lubricated the gear system. The power loss was eliminated, gear noise stopped, and the crankshaft assembly resumed normal operation.

How do I resolve crankshaft misalignment issues?Crankshaft misalignment is typically caused by worn shim sets, damaged locating rings, or loose bolts. First, replace the GH3101-02.19.00 Shim Set and any damaged locating rings with our compatible parts. Tighten all bolts to the recommended torque and use a dial indicator to adjust alignment to within ±0.02mm.
